Jamaican Curry Chicken Recipe

Jamaican Curry Chicken Recipe

This easy Jamaican Curry Chicken Recipe is delicious. I make it every month.
Prep Time 10 minutes
Cook Time 38 minutes
Total Time 48 minutes
Course Main Course
Cuisine Jamaican
Servings 4 Servings
Calories 278 kcal

Ingredients
  

  • 2 lbs of boneless skinless chicken breasts, cut into bite-sized pieces
  • 2 tbsp of vegetable oil
  • 1 onion chopped
  • 2 cloves of garlic minced
  • 2 tbsp of Jamaican curry powder
  • 1 tsp of cumin
  • 1 tsp of allspice
  • 1 tsp of thyme
  • 1/2 tsp of salt
  • 1/2 tsp of black pepper
  • 1 cup of chicken broth
  • 1/2 cup of coconut milk

Instructions
 

  • Heat the vegetable oil in a large pot over medium heat.
  • Add the onion and garlic and sauté for 2-3 minutes until the onion is softened and fragrant.
  • Add the curry powder, cumin, allspice, thyme, salt, and black pepper to the pot and stir to combine. Sauté the spices for 1-2 minutes until they are fragrant and toasted.
  • Add the chicken pieces to the pot and stir to coat them in the spice mixture. Sauté the chicken for 2-3 minutes until it is lightly browned on all sides.
  • Pour the chicken broth and coconut milk into the pot, and stir to combine. Bring the mixture to a simmer, and then reduce the heat to low. Cover the pot and allow the curry to cook for 15-20 minutes, or until the chicken is cooked through and tender.
  • Serve the curry hot with your choice of rice and peas. Enjoy!
